6. 5G and Connectivity
The rollout of 5G networks will revolutionize connectivity, enabling faster communication and more connected devices. By 2025, the implications will include:
- Smart Cities: Enhanced infrastructure and services using IoT devices.
- Telemedicine: Improved remote health services through reliable connectivity.
- Entertainment: Streaming content in higher quality and virtual reality experiences.
Advantages of 5G Technology
The benefits of widespread 5G adoption will be significant:
- Increased data transfer speeds.
- Lower latency for real-time applications.
- Greater capacity for connected devices.
7. Digital Privacy and Security
With the increasing digitization of personal information, digital privacy will be paramount. By 2025, individuals can expect:
- Stricter Regulations: Governments enacting policies to protect consumer data.
- Privacy Tools: Enhanced software tools for managing personal data.
- Decentralized Identity Systems: Allowing individuals greater control over their identities.
Strategies for Safeguarding Privacy
To enhance personal digital security, consider:
- Utilizing VPNs to secure online activities.
- Implementing two-factor authentication.
- Regularly updating passwords and security settings.
